摘要: 综述了聚醚醚酮(PEEK)、聚醚酰亚胺(PEI)、聚四氟乙烯(PTFE)、热致液晶(TLCP)和聚醚砜(PES)等高性能工程塑料的共混改性研究进展,详细探讨了各种PEEK共混物的相容性、结晶行为、微观结构、热行为和力学性能等性能特征。PEEK与PEI在熔融和无定形状态下完全相容,常用于PEEK的结晶行为和微观结构的基础研究;与PTFE、TLCP、PES共混分别是提高PEEK的摩擦磨损性能、加工性能和热稳定性的有效手段。各种共混物的相容性好坏对其结晶行为和微观结构有重要影响,从而影响了共混物的力学性能。在此基础上,对PEEK共混改性领域进一步的研究方向和内容进行了讨论。

Abstract: Research progress in blends of PEEK with other high performance engineering plastics such as poly(ether imide) (PEI), polytetrafluoroethylene (PTFE), thermotropic liquid crystalline polymer(TLCP) and poly(ether sulfone)(PES)was reviewed, and the miscibility,crystallization behavior,morphology,thermal behavior,and mechanical properties of PEEK blends were discussed.In melt and amorphous states,PEEK is completely miscible with PEI,and their blend is generally used in the fundamental studies on the crystallization behaviors and microstructures. Blending PEEK with PTFE,TLCP and PES is an effective way to improve the friction and wear performance, processability and thermal stability.Based on these research results,further research directions and contents in PEEK blends are also anticipated.
